Paul Gallen, the former captain of New South Wales, has launched a passionate critique of Queensland's claims to underdog status ahead of the upcoming State of Origin series. Speaking on 2GB radio in Sydney, Gallen expressed his frustration, labeling the Maroons' self-proclaimed underdog narrative as 'sickening' and 'embarrassing.' He pointed out that Queensland has historically outperformed New South Wales, winning more games and series, which makes their claims even more perplexing. Gallen emphasized that the media and fans should not buy into the underdog myth, noting that Queensland's success includes periods of dominance, such as their eight consecutive series wins from 2006 to 2013. As the series opener approaches, with bookmakers listing Queensland as $2.30 outsiders compared to New South Wales at $1.65, Gallen has promised to remind Queensland fans of their shortcomings if NSW secures a victory this year.
